2025全新升级:Pydantic-AI v1.0.1重磅发布,模型配置与多平台支持全面增强
2025全新升级:Pydantic-AI v1.0.1重磅发布,模型配置与多平台支持全面增强
Pydantic-AI是一款基于Pydantic构建的AI Agent框架,v1.0.1版本带来了模型配置优化和多平台支持增强等重要更新,为开发者打造更高效、更灵活的AI应用开发体验。
一、核心功能亮点:全面提升开发效率
1. 多模型集成,一键切换无压力 🚀
Pydantic-AI v1.0.1实现了对主流AI模型的无缝集成,包括Anthropic、OpenAI、Google Gemini等。通过统一的接口设计,开发者无需修改核心代码即可切换不同模型,极大降低了多模型开发的复杂度。相关实现可参考models/目录下的模型封装代码。
2. 强大的监控与分析能力
新版本强化了与Logfire的集成,提供实时监控和性能分析功能。通过直观的仪表盘,开发者可以轻松跟踪AI Agent的运行状态、性能指标和错误情况,及时发现并解决问题。
二、快速上手:5分钟搭建你的第一个AI Agent
1. 环境准备
首先,克隆仓库到本地:
git clone https://gitcode.com/GitHub_Trending/py/pydantic-ai
cd pydantic-ai
2. 安装依赖
使用uv或pip安装项目依赖:
uv install
# 或
pip install -e .
3. 构建简单聊天应用
Pydantic-AI提供了丰富的示例代码,帮助开发者快速入门。以聊天应用为例,只需几行代码即可实现一个功能完善的AI聊天界面:
相关代码可参考examples/chat_app.py文件。
三、高级特性:让AI应用更智能、更可靠
1. 自动化评估与测试
v1.0.1版本引入了强大的评估工具,帮助开发者量化AI Agent的性能。通过evals/模块,你可以轻松创建测试用例、运行评估并生成详细报告,确保AI应用的质量和可靠性。
2. 灵活的工具集成
Pydantic-AI支持自定义工具集成,开发者可以轻松扩展AI Agent的能力。无论是数据库查询、API调用还是文件处理,都可以通过简单的配置将其集成到AI工作流中,相关文档可参考tools.md。
四、升级指南:从旧版本平滑过渡
如果你正在使用Pydantic-AI的旧版本,升级到v1.0.1非常简单。详细的升级步骤和注意事项请参考changelog.md,确保你的应用顺利迁移到新版本。
五、结语:开启AI应用开发新体验
Pydantic-AI v1.0.1的发布为AI Agent开发带来了更强大、更灵活的工具集。无论你是AI应用开发新手还是经验丰富的开发者,都能从中受益。立即下载体验,开启你的AI应用开发之旅吧!
更多详细文档和示例,请参考项目docs/目录。如果你有任何问题或建议,欢迎参与项目贡献,一起完善Pydantic-AI生态。
更多推荐





所有评论(0)